extent of consensus
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"extent of consensus"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ing the level or degree to which agreement exists among a group of people or stakeholders. Example: "The extent of consensus among the committee members was crucial in determining the final decision on the project."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When using the phrase "extent of consensus", ensure that you clearly define the group or population whose consensus you are referring to.
Common error
Avoid using "extent of consensus" when there is clear dissent or a lack of widespread agreement. Instead, acknowledge dissenting viewpoints to maintain accuracy and credibility.

FAQs
How can I use "extent of consensus" in a sentence?
You can use "extent of consensus" to discuss the degree of agreement within a group, as in "The "extent of consensus" among the board members was surprisingly high on the new proposal.".
What's the difference between ""extent of consensus"" and "level of agreement"?
While similar, ""extent of consensus"" often implies a broader scope of agreement, whereas "level of agreement" focuses more on the intensity or degree to which individuals agree.
What can I say instead of ""extent of consensus""?
You can use alternatives like "degree of agreement", "level of accord", or "scope of concurrence" depending on the specific nuance you wish to convey.
In what contexts is it appropriate to use the phrase ""extent of consensus""?
It's suitable in situations where you need to evaluate or describe the degree of agreement among a group of people, such as in research studies, policy discussions, or business negotiations.
